Abstract


This paper introduces an implementation of pulse-width modulation (PWM) known as simple boost PWM (SBPWM) for Z-source inverter (ZSI) under open-loop system for five-phase application. A detail assessment of the inverter by comparing the simulation with the theoretical output voltage, determining total harmonic distortion (THD) of the output under EN61000-3-2 standard and investigating the effect of modulation index over voltage gain, output voltage (line-line) and total power dissipation. A model of five-phase ZSI was built in MATLAB/Simulink with resistive load. The findings from the analysis show that the results obtained from the theoretical and simulation is similar, the THD comply with EN61000-3-2 standard which obtain below 2%, and reducing the modulation index will increase the voltage gain, output voltage (line-line) and total power dissipation.
